FIVE STEPS BEFORE YOU INVEST IN MACHINE TOOLS

1) STUDYING THE PART CLAMPING SYSTEM: Today, as the parts to be produced are increasingly complicated and the tolerances are narrower and narrower, the method used to clamp the part to be produced is actually a VERY CRITICAL aspect,  consequently it has to examined in depth as underestimating it may determine whether the investment is right or wrong.

 

2) STUDYING THE WORK CYCLE: This phase is needed to decide how many tools are needed in order to process the piece, complying with all the set tolerances, roughing, finishing, etc. This phase allows the customer and the supplier to clarify and agree upon

 

3) STUDYING OF THE CYCLE EXECUTION TIME:  This phase represents the third important step, because it is the right cycle time (time needed to make a complete piece) that allows the investment to pay for itself. However, the opposite is also true: with the wrong cycle time, the investment does not pay for itself and the catastrophe begins.

 

4) COST PER PIECE: This step is crucial, with its variable data and fixed data, such as:

  • Work days
  • Investment years
  • Plant yield
  • Operators needed to run the plant
  • Hourly labour cost
  • Estimated cost for annual maintenance
  • Plant write-up coefficient (Inflation)
  • Plant write-down coefficient
  • Cost of equipment
  • Cost of tools
  • Plant installed power
  • Power utilisation factor
  • Cost of electricity
  • Plant cost
  • Hourly production

From this huge mass of INPUT data, we can define the cost per piece because, by entering it in a specific formula, we obtain OUTPUT data that tells us the value of each one of the items listed here below in cents of a euro:

  • Plant depreciation rate
  • Plant maintenance cost
  • Labour cost
  • Equipment cost
  • Tools cost
  • Electricity cost

By adding up each singe cost, we obtain the cost per piece, in other words the processing cost, if and only if…

 

5) EVALUATION OF PRODUCTION LOTS: Many companies stop at step 4. In fact, this made sense in the past: producing as much as possible at a hectic pace. Nowadays, the step that determines the COST PER PIECE is no longer enough, since there are fewer and fewer large lots, consequently the problems with producing as in the past are:

  • VALUE OF STOCK ON HAND TOO HIGH
  • WRONG SALES FORECASTS OR SCHEDULES/PROMISES NOT FOLLOWED OR KEPT BY CUSTOMERS
  • ANY CHANGES TO THE PIECE WOULD BE EXTREMELY EXPENSIVE SINCE THE PIECE HAS ALREADY BEEN PRODUCED
  • REDUCED COMPANY LIQUIDITY DUE TO THE HIGH STOCK VALUE
  • VERY SLOW TOOLING TIMES AND POOR FLEXIBILITY FOR NEW PRODUCTS

 

So, as you can see, the COST PER PIECE is no longer enough.

A company MUST NOT simply produce as fast as possible, as another variable needs to be introduced: item 5 “EVALUATION OF PRODUCTION LOTS”, which is nothing but what the market requests. In the past, the market always asked for better and better quality and for lower and lower costs per piece.

In fact, in the world of machine tools the TRANSFER has been extremely successful since it was able to meet these two requests. Nowadays, the market has changed. Today’s market is increasingly asking for:

 

  • QUICK DELIVERIES
  • THE POSSIBILITY TO KEEP THE SAME ANNUAL VOLUMES BUT WITH SMALLER AND SMALLER LOTS
  • LAST-MINUTE CHANGES
  • CHANGES DURING PRODUCTION
  • BURR-FREE PIECES
  • FAST RE-TOOLING
  • SMALLER AND SMALLER LOTS
  • MORE AND MORE COMPLEX COMPONENTS

 

With the type of requests listed above, it is easy to understand that the COST PER PIECE alone no longer meets the requests; of course it is a useful piece of information, but it has to be supplemented by the other aforementioned variables.
